  • 2 fear

    [fɪə]
    n
    1) страх, боязнь

    I dared not move for fear of the dog. — Я не решался пошевельнуться, боясь собаки.

    He didn't call for fear of disturbing you so late. — Он не позвонил, боясь побеспокоить вас так поздно.

    - ever-present fear
    - fear of death
    - in fear for his life
    - without fear
    - for fear of smth
    - for fear of doing smth
    - live in constant fear of smth
    - stand in fear of his anger
    - feel no fear
    2) опасения, страхи (обыкновенно pl)

    Her fears were well grounded. — Ее опасения имели серьезные основания.

    She didn't jump for fear that she might hurt herself. — Она не прыгала, опасаясь/боясь ушибиться.

    USAGE:
    В английских словосочетаниях, эквивалентных русскому чувствовать страх, существительное fear, как правило, не употребляется с глаголом to feel. B этих случаях употребляются сочетания to be afraid и to be frightened
